Key Takeaways:

  • Incident Overview: Over $200 million stolen from DEX Cetus on the Sui blockchain.
  • Market Impact: Significant drops in value for several tokens; LBTC surprisingly rising by 4%.
  • Official Response: Smart contracts paused for investigation; users advised to remain vigilant.
  • Broader Implications: Challenges for the security of decentralized platforms and the entire Web3 ecosystem.

So, the first whispers about this attack came from a pseudonymous researcher who spotted some suspicious activity on Cetus. Apparently, there was a massive spike in transaction activity - we’re talking an epic jump from $320 million to nearly $2.9 billion during the scam. That’s some serious extraction happening right under our noses!

You see, hackers transferred about $63 million to Ethereum right after the exploit. If you ask me, that’s a pretty classic move in the crypto playbook. Then you’ve got 20,000 ETH all funneled to a shiny new wallet. It’s like robbing a safe and running straight to a nearby pawn shop.

The response from the market has been mixed- what a surprise, right? I mean, some tokens like LBTC actually gained 4% in value, which is kinda baffling. Meanwhile, other tokens on the DEX like AXOLcoin saw their values take a nosedive, dropping over 75%. The Cetus team has essentially hit the brakes, pausing the smart contracts and starting an internal investigation. They’ve acknowledged there’s a problem, but no one expects them to fix this overnight. You know how it is-trust has been shattered, and clarity is key. Users across the board are left in the lurch, and it’s clear the response doesn’t quite match the scale of the disaster.

Onchain analyses pointed out that the funds were moved at breakneck speed-about $1 million per minute-which raises serious eyebrows. The speed and chaos of these transactions don’t just scream “hack!”; they also hint at a more orchestrated approach, maybe even a planned operation. This is not just some amateur hour, folks.
